The Deep Fried Pickles are a delectable musical treat. They pride themselves on making jug-a-billy music that would make Hee-Haw's Grandpa Jones shake, rattle and roll over in his grave. Founded in '00 as a jug band, 'DFPP' now mixes other American roots forms into the breading batter as well. Bluegrass, Folk, Rockabilly, Blues and Honky-Tonk tunes pepper their set lists. This CD is a benefit for Hurricane Katrina Victims. “If 'Hee-Haw and 'H.R. Puffenstuff' had a child, it would sound like the PICKLE PROJECT; Jug-a-billy cow-punk at its squishiest!”
